概要

In Elizabethan England, two affluent families find themselves as neighbors, separated not just by land but by deep-seated religious divides—one family staunchly Catholic, the other fiercely Protestant. Amidst this tumultuous backdrop, the young heirs of both families are irresistibly drawn to one another, forging a bond of friendship and love that defies their parents beliefs. As Catholics endure persecution, fines, imprisonment, and even execution for their faith, some choose betrayal, complicating the already fraught landscape. As tensions mount and the plot thickens, unexpected heroes emerge, wrestling with profound theological dilemmas and facing unimaginable suffering. Each character, whether brilliant or superstitious, steadfast or wavering, paints a vivid portrait of a turbulent era. Join historical figures like St. Edmond Campion and Queen Elizabeth as they navigate a world where love, history, and faith collide, culminating in a rich tapestry of suspense and intrigue.
